DID YOU KNOW?
- Santa Claus is from ‘Sinterklaas’ which means Saint Nicholas in Dutch. St. Nicholas was a Christian bishop who lived in the 4th century – known for being kind and generous, he later became the patron saint of children.
- The classic image of a happy and plump Father Christmas or Santa Claus that we know today was inspired from Coca-Cola ads, drawn in 1931 by illustrator Haddon Sundblom.
